Show patches with: Submitter = Christoph Hellwig       |    State = Action Required       |   5587 patches
« 1 2 ... 14 15 1655 56 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
[4/4] rnbd-srv: remove struct rnbd_dev [1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p 1 1 - --- 2022-09-09 Christoph Hellwig New
[3/4] rnbd-srv: remove rnbd_dev_{open,close} [1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p 1 1 - --- 2022-09-09 Christoph Hellwig New
[2/4] rnbd-srv: remove rnbd_endio [1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p 1 1 - --- 2022-09-09 Christoph Hellwig New
[1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p [1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p 1 1 - --- 2022-09-09 Christoph Hellwig New
block: split bio_check_pages_dirty block: split bio_check_pages_dirty - - - --- 2022-09-09 Christoph Hellwig New
[17/17] iomap: remove IOMAP_F_ZONE_APPEND [01/17] block: export bio_split_rw - 3 - --- 2022-09-01 Christoph Hellwig New
[16/17] btrfs: split zone append bios in btrfs_submit_bio [01/17] block: export bio_split_rw - 1 - --- 2022-09-01 Christoph Hellwig New
[15/17] btrfs: calculate file system wide queue limit for zoned mode [01/17] block: export bio_split_rw - - - --- 2022-09-01 Christoph Hellwig New
[14/17] btrfs: remove now spurious bio submission helpers [01/17] block: export bio_split_rw - 2 - --- 2022-09-01 Christoph Hellwig New
[13/17] btrfs: remove submit_encoded_read_bio [01/17] block: export bio_split_rw - 2 - --- 2022-09-01 Christoph Hellwig New
[12/17] btrfs: remove struct btrfs_io_geometry [01/17] block: export bio_split_rw - 1 - --- 2022-09-01 Christoph Hellwig New
[11/17] btrfs: remove stripe boundary calculation for encoded I/O [01/17] block: export bio_split_rw - 2 - --- 2022-09-01 Christoph Hellwig New
[10/17] btrfs: remove stripe boundary calculation for compressed I/O [01/17] block: export bio_split_rw - 1 - --- 2022-09-01 Christoph Hellwig New
[09/17] btrfs: remove stripe boundary calculation for buffered I/O [01/17] block: export bio_split_rw - 1 - --- 2022-09-01 Christoph Hellwig New
[08/17] btrfs: pass the iomap bio to btrfs_submit_bio [01/17] block: export bio_split_rw - 1 - --- 2022-09-01 Christoph Hellwig New
[07/17] btrfs: allow btrfs_submit_bio to split bios [01/17] block: export bio_split_rw - 2 - --- 2022-09-01 Christoph Hellwig New
[06/17] btrfs: handle recording of zoned writes in the storage layer [01/17] block: export bio_split_rw - 3 - --- 2022-09-01 Christoph Hellwig New
[05/17] btrfs: handle checksum generation in the storage layer [01/17] block: export bio_split_rw - 1 - --- 2022-09-01 Christoph Hellwig New
[04/17] btrfs: handle checksum validation and repair at the storage layer [01/17] block: export bio_split_rw - - - --- 2022-09-01 Christoph Hellwig New
[03/17] btrfs: move repair_io_failure to volumes.c [01/17] block: export bio_split_rw - 1 - --- 2022-09-01 Christoph Hellwig New
[02/17] btrfs: stop tracking failed reads in the I/O tree [01/17] block: export bio_split_rw - 2 - --- 2022-09-01 Christoph Hellwig New
[01/17] block: export bio_split_rw [01/17] block: export bio_split_rw - 2 - --- 2022-09-01 Christoph Hellwig New
[4/4] rnbd-srv: remove struct rnbd_dev [1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p - 1 - --- 2022-08-22 Christoph Hellwig New
[3/4] rnbd-srv: remove rnbd_dev_{open,close} [1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p - 1 - --- 2022-08-22 Christoph Hellwig New
[2/4] rnbd-srv: remove rnbd_endio [1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p - 1 - --- 2022-08-22 Christoph Hellwig New
[1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p [1/4] rnbd-srv: simplify rnbd_srv_fill_msg_open_rsp - 1 - --- 2022-08-22 Christoph Hellwig New
[6/6] block: pass struct queue_limits to the bio splitting helpers [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-27 Christoph Hellwig New
[5/6] block: move bio_allowed_max_sectors to blk-merge.c [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-27 Christoph Hellwig New
[4/6] block: move the call to get_max_io_size out of blk_bio_segment_split [1/6] block: change the blk_queue_split calling convention - 3 - --- 2022-07-27 Christoph Hellwig New
[3/6] block: move ->bio_split to the gendisk [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-27 Christoph Hellwig New
[2/6] block: change the blk_queue_bounce calling convention [1/6] block: change the blk_queue_split calling convention - 3 - --- 2022-07-27 Christoph Hellwig New
[1/6] block: change the blk_queue_split calling convention [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-27 Christoph Hellwig New
[6/6] block: pass struct queue_limits to the bio splitting helpers [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-26 Christoph Hellwig New
[5/6] block: move bio_allowed_max_sectors to blk-merge.c [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-26 Christoph Hellwig New
[4/6] block: move the call to get_max_io_size out of blk_bio_segment_split [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-26 Christoph Hellwig New
[3/6] block: move ->bio_split to the gendisk [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-26 Christoph Hellwig New
[2/6] block: change the blk_queue_bounce calling convention [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-26 Christoph Hellwig New
[1/6] block: change the blk_queue_split calling convention [1/6] block: change the blk_queue_split calling convention - - - --- 2022-07-26 Christoph Hellwig New
[6/6] block: pass struct queue_limits to the bio splitting helpers [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-23 Christoph Hellwig New
[5/6] block: move bio_allowed_max_sectors to blk-merge.c [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-23 Christoph Hellwig New
[4/6] block: move the call to get_max_io_size out of blk_bio_segment_split [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-23 Christoph Hellwig New
[3/6] block: move ->bio_split to the gendisk [1/6] block: change the blk_queue_split calling convention - 2 - --- 2022-07-23 Christoph Hellwig New
[2/6] block: change the blk_queue_bounce calling convention [1/6] block: change the blk_queue_split calling convention - - - --- 2022-07-23 Christoph Hellwig New
[1/6] block: change the blk_queue_split calling convention [1/6] block: change the blk_queue_split calling convention - - - --- 2022-07-23 Christoph Hellwig New
[8/8] ublk: defer disk allocation [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[7/8] ublk: rewrite ublk_ctrl_get_queue_affinity to not rely on hctx->cpumask [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[6/8] ublk: fold __ublk_create_dev into ublk_ctrl_add_dev [1/8] ublk: add a MAINTAINERS entry - 2 - --- 2022-07-21 Christoph Hellwig New
[5/8] ublk: cleanup ublk_ctrl_uring_cmd [1/8] ublk: add a MAINTAINERS entry - 2 - --- 2022-07-21 Christoph Hellwig New
[4/8] ublk: simplify ublk_ch_open and ublk_ch_release [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[3/8] ublk: remove the empty open and release block device operations [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[2/8] ublk: remove UBLK_IO_F_PREFLUSH [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[1/8] ublk: add a MAINTAINERS entry [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
RFC: what to do about fscrypt vs block device interaction RFC: what to do about fscrypt vs block device interaction - - - --- 2022-07-21 Christoph Hellwig New
remove the sx8 block driver remove the sx8 block driver - - - --- 2022-07-21 Christoph Hellwig New
block: remove __blk_get_queue block: remove __blk_get_queue - 2 - --- 2022-07-21 Christoph Hellwig New
[8/8] ublk: defer disk allocation [1/8] ublk: add a MAINTAINERS entry - - - --- 2022-07-21 Christoph Hellwig New
[7/8] ublk: rewrite ublk_ctrl_get_queue_affinity to not rely on hctx->cpumask [1/8] ublk: add a MAINTAINERS entry - - - --- 2022-07-21 Christoph Hellwig New
[6/8] ublk: fold __ublk_create_dev into ublk_ctrl_add_dev [1/8] ublk: add a MAINTAINERS entry - 2 - --- 2022-07-21 Christoph Hellwig New
[5/8] ublk: cleanup ublk_ctrl_uring_cmd [1/8] ublk: add a MAINTAINERS entry - 2 - --- 2022-07-21 Christoph Hellwig New
[4/8] ublk: simplify ublk_ch_open and ublk_ch_release [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[3/8] ublk: remove the empty open and release block device operations [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[2/8] ublk: remove UBLK_IO_F_PREFLUSH [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[1/8] ublk: add a MAINTAINERS entry [1/8] ublk: add a MAINTAINERS entry - 1 - --- 2022-07-21 Christoph Hellwig New
[5/5] block: pass struct queue_limits to the bio splitting helpers [1/5] block: move ->bio_split to the gendisk - 1 - --- 2022-07-20 Christoph Hellwig New
[4/5] block: move bio_allowed_max_sectors to blk-merge.c [1/5] block: move ->bio_split to the gendisk - 1 - --- 2022-07-20 Christoph Hellwig New
[3/5] block: move the call to get_max_io_size out of blk_bio_segment_split [1/5] block: move ->bio_split to the gendisk - 1 - --- 2022-07-20 Christoph Hellwig New
[2/5] block: fix max_zone_append_sectors inheritance in blk_stack_limits [1/5] block: move ->bio_split to the gendisk - - - --- 2022-07-20 Christoph Hellwig New
[1/5] block: move ->bio_split to the gendisk [1/5] block: move ->bio_split to the gendisk - 1 - --- 2022-07-20 Christoph Hellwig New
[2/2] block: call blk_mq_exit_queue from disk_release for never added disks [1/2] blk-mq: fix error handling in __blk_mq_alloc_disk - 1 - --- 2022-07-20 Christoph Hellwig New
[1/2] blk-mq: fix error handling in __blk_mq_alloc_disk [1/2] blk-mq: fix error handling in __blk_mq_alloc_disk - 1 - --- 2022-07-20 Christoph Hellwig New
[10/10] md: simplify md_open [01/10] md: fix mddev->kobj lifetime - 1 - --- 2022-07-19 Christoph Hellwig New
[09/10] md: only delete entries from all_mddevs when the disk is freed [01/10] md: fix mddev->kobj lifetime - 1 - --- 2022-07-19 Christoph Hellwig New
[08/10] md: stop using for_each_mddev in md_exit [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-19 Christoph Hellwig New
[07/10] md: stop using for_each_mddev in md_notify_reboot [01/10] md: fix mddev->kobj lifetime - 3 - --- 2022-07-19 Christoph Hellwig New
[06/10] md: stop using for_each_mddev in md_do_sync [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-19 Christoph Hellwig New
[05/10] md: factor out the rdev overlaps check from rdev_size_store [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-19 Christoph Hellwig New
[04/10] md: rename md_free to md_kobj_release [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-19 Christoph Hellwig New
[03/10] md: implement ->free_disk [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-19 Christoph Hellwig New
[02/10] md: fix error handling in md_alloc [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-19 Christoph Hellwig New
[01/10] md: fix mddev->kobj lifetime [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-19 Christoph Hellwig New
[10/10] md: simplify md_open [01/10] md: fix mddev->kobj lifetime - 1 - --- 2022-07-18 Christoph Hellwig New
[09/10] md: only delete entries from all_mddevs when the disk is freed [01/10] md: fix mddev->kobj lifetime - - - --- 2022-07-18 Christoph Hellwig New
[08/10] md: stop using for_each_mddev in md_exit [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-18 Christoph Hellwig New
[07/10] md: stop using for_each_mddev in md_notify_reboot [01/10] md: fix mddev->kobj lifetime - 3 - --- 2022-07-18 Christoph Hellwig New
[06/10] md: stop using for_each_mddev in md_do_sync [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-18 Christoph Hellwig New
[05/10] md: factor out the rdev overlaps check from rdev_size_store [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-18 Christoph Hellwig New
[04/10] md: rename md_free to md_kobj_release [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-18 Christoph Hellwig New
[03/10] md: implement ->free_disk [01/10] md: fix mddev->kobj lifetime - 1 - --- 2022-07-18 Christoph Hellwig New
[02/10] md: fix error handling in md_alloc [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-18 Christoph Hellwig New
[01/10] md: fix mddev->kobj lifetime [01/10] md: fix mddev->kobj lifetime - 2 - --- 2022-07-18 Christoph Hellwig New
ublk: remove UBLK_IO_F_INTEGRITY ublk: remove UBLK_IO_F_INTEGRITY - - - --- 2022-07-18 Christoph Hellwig New
[2/2] Revert "ublk_drv: fix request queue leak" [1/2] block: call blk_mq_exit_queue from disk_release for never added disks - - - --- 2022-07-18 Christoph Hellwig New
[1/2] block: call blk_mq_exit_queue from disk_release for never added disks [1/2] block: call blk_mq_exit_queue from disk_release for never added disks - - - --- 2022-07-18 Christoph Hellwig New
[9/9] md: simplify md_open [1/9] md: fix error handling in md_alloc - - - --- 2022-07-13 Christoph Hellwig New
[8/9] md: only delete entries from all_mddevs when the disk is freed [1/9] md: fix error handling in md_alloc - - - --- 2022-07-13 Christoph Hellwig New
[7/9] md: stop using for_each_mddev in md_exit [1/9] md: fix error handling in md_alloc - - - --- 2022-07-13 Christoph Hellwig New
[6/9] md: stop using for_each_mddev in md_notify_reboot [1/9] md: fix error handling in md_alloc - 1 - --- 2022-07-13 Christoph Hellwig New
[5/9] md: stop using for_each_mddev in md_do_sync [1/9] md: fix error handling in md_alloc - - - --- 2022-07-13 Christoph Hellwig New
[4/9] md: factor out the rdev overlaps check from rdev_size_store [1/9] md: fix error handling in md_alloc - - - --- 2022-07-13 Christoph Hellwig New
[3/9] md: rename md_free to md_kobj_release [1/9] md: fix error handling in md_alloc 1 - - --- 2022-07-13 Christoph Hellwig New
« 1 2 ... 14 15 1655 56 »